WebFeb 13, 2024 · sliding hiatus hernias – hernias that move up and down, in and out of the chest area (more than 80% of hiatus hernias are of this type) para-oesophageal hiatus hernias – also called rolling hiatus hernias, where part of the stomach pushes up through the hole in the diaphragm next to the oesophagus (about 5-15% of hiatus hernias are of this … WebFig.3 Hill Grade III: the fold is not promi-nent and the endo-scope is not tightly gripped by the tissue. Fig.4 Hill Grade IV: there is no fold, and the lumen of the esopha-gus is open, often …

WebBasically, what the hiatus hernia, or hiatal hernia is is a dilation of the hole in the diaphragm. The diaphragm is a big tent muscle that separates the chest and the abdomen. When the diaphragm, it’s usually a dome-shaped structure, and when you breathe in, it flattens out. It expands the chest. It lets you bring in air into your lungs. WebEsophageal hiatal hernia involves abnormal abdominal entry into thoracic cavity. It is classified based on orientation between esophageal junction and diaphragm. Sliding hiatal hernia (Type-I) comprises the most frequent category, emanating from right crus of diaphragm.
